Power supply
6.3.1
5 V power supply general view
The STM32L562E-DK Discovery kit is designed to be powered from 5 V DC power source.
One of the following 5 V DC power inputs can be used, upon an appropriate board configuration:
•
5V_STLK provided by a host PC connected to CN17 through a Micro-B USB cable (default
configuration)
•
5V_VIN provided by an external 7-12V power supply connected to
CN18
pin 8 (ARDUINO
®
)
•
5V_UCPD provided by a host PC connected to
CN15
through a USB Type-C
™
cable.
•
5V_PM provided by a host PC connected to
CN16
through a Micro-B USB cable (This one is used for the
energy meter function).
•
5V_CHG provided by a 5 V USB charger connected to
CN17
through a Micro-B USB cable
•
5V_DC provided by an external 5V_DC source on ARDUINO
®
CN18 pin 5, or directly after the JP4
connector for 5 V selection
When 5V_VIN, 5V_CHG, 5V_DC or 3V3 is used to power the STM32L562E-DK board, this power source must
comply with the standard EN-60950-1: 2006+A11/2009 and must be Safety Extra Low Voltage (SELV) with limited
power capability
LD12 Green LED turns on when the voltage on the power line marked as 5 V is present. All supply lines required
for the operation of the components on STM32L562E-DK are derived from that 5 V line.
When the power supply is external 3V3 or 5V_CHG on CN17, the STLINK-V3E can not be used.

Table 7.
Power supply capabilities
Input power
name
Connector pins
Input voltage
range
Max.
current
Limitation
5V_STLK
CN17 pin 1
JP4 [1-2]
4.75 to 5.25 V
500 mA
The maximum current depends on the USB enumeration:
•
100 mA without enumeration
•
500 mA with correct enumeration
5V_VIN
CN18 pin 8
JP4 [3-4]
7 to 12 V
-
From 7 V to 12 V only and input current capability is
linked to input voltage:
•
800 mA input current when VIN=7 V
•
450 mA input current when 7V<VIN<9 V
•
250 mA input current when 9 V<VIN<12 V
5V_UCPB
CN15
JP4 [5-6]
4.75 to 5.25 V
1 A
The maximum current depends on the USB host used to
power the board.
5V_PM
CN16 pin 1
JP4 [7-8]
4.75 to 5.25 V
500 mA
The maximum current depends on the USB enumeration:
•
100 mA without enumeration.
•
500 mA with correct enumeration
5V_CHG
CN17 pin 1
JP4 [9-10]
4.75 to 5.25 V
-
The maximum current depends on the USB charger used
to power the board.
5V_DC
CN18 pin 5
JP4 pin
2/4/6/8/10
JUMPER OFF
4.75 to 5.25 V
-
The maximum current depends on the 5V_DC used to
power the board.
